Carbon emissions from fossil fuels, cement up 38 percent since 1992, says report; Chi
Oak Ridge National Laboratory has issued a report that carbon dioxide emissions from burning fossil fuels and cement manufacturing have increased 38% since 1992,* from 6.1 billion metric tons of carbon in 1992 to 8.5 billion metric tons in 2007.
